We're partnering with a rapidly growing, private equity-backed healthcare organization on the search for an FP&A Analyst to join its finance & strategy team.
Over the past decade, the company has grown from a single location into a market-leading multi-site platform across multiple states. Backed by supportive investors and led by a highly regarded executive team, the business continues to expand through both organic growth and acquisitions.
Reporting directly to the SVP of Finance, this is a unique opportunity for an ambitious analyst to gain exposure far beyond traditional FP&A. You'll work on everything from budgeting and forecasting to M&A analysis, operational performance, strategic initiatives, and executive-level decision support.
The environment is fast-paced and demanding, but for the right person it offers tremendous learning opportunities and career growth.
What you'll be doing:
- Support budgeting, forecasting, and management reporting across a large and growing multi-site business
- Help maintain and enhance complex financial models used to support planning, growth initiatives, and strategic decision-making
- Analyze performance across operating locations, identifying trends, risks, opportunities, and key drivers of profitability
- Prepare presentations, reporting packages, and analysis for senior leadership and investors
- Partner with leadership on acquisition analysis, integration activities, and other strategic projects
- Assist with business case development, ROI analysis, and operational improvement initiatives
- Support process improvement efforts across reporting, planning, and financial analysis
- Work closely with executive leadership on ad hoc projects ranging from financing initiatives to long-term growth planning
What we're looking for:
- 2-4 years of experience in FP&A, strategic finance, consulting, corporate finance, or a similar analytical environment
- Strong Excel and financial modeling skills
- Analytical mindset with the ability to turn data into actionable insights
- Someone who enjoys operating in a fast-moving environment and is willing to roll up their sleeves when needed
- Strong communication skills and the confidence to work with senior stakeholders
- Healthcare experience is a plus but not required
